Introduction and Conclusion
Ensure your essay has a clear introductory paragraph that outlines your viewpoint and previews the arguments you will make. Your conclusion should summarise your arguments and restate your opinion.
Cohesion and Cohere
Make sure your essay has a logical flow, with each paragraph smoothly transitioning to the next. Use linking words and phrases to help guide the reader through your arguments.
Supporting Examples
Support each argument with clear, relevant examples. While you have provided some reasoning, more specific examples could strengthen your arguments.
Grammar and Sentence Structure
Proofread your essay to correct grammatical errors and improve sentence structure. This will help make your arguments more clear and persuasive.
Spelling and Accuracy
Be cautious with spelling and ensure proper use of terminology, especially concerning the topic. For example, it's 'exploit' not 'exploite', and 'biological' not 'bilogical'.

To get an excellent score in the IELTS Task 2 writing section, one of the easiest and most effective tips is structuring your writing in the most solid format. A great argument essay structure may be divided to four paragraphs, in which comprises of four sentences (excluding the conclusion paragraph, which comprises of three sentences).

For we to consider an essay structure a great one, it should be looking like this:

  • Paragraph 1 - Introduction
    • Sentence 1 - Background statement
    • Sentence 2 - Detailed background statement
    • Sentence 3 - Thesis
    • Sentence 4 - Outline sentence
  • Paragraph 2 - First supporting paragraph
    • Sentence 1 - Topic sentence
    • Sentence 2 - Example
    • Sentence 3 - Discussion
    • Sentence 4 - Conclusion
  • Paragraph 3 - Second supporting paragraph
    • Sentence 1 - Topic sentence
    • Sentence 2 - Example
    • Sentence 3 - Discussion
    • Sentence 4 - Conclusion
  • Paragraph 4 - Conclusion
    • Sentence 1 - Summary
    • Sentence 2 - Restatement of thesis
    • Sentence 3 - Prediction or recommendation

Our recommended essay structure above comprises of fifteen (15) sentences, which will make your essay approximately 250 to 275 words.
